"Leaving Iowa" Coming to Pittsville

Roles are available for three men and three women, although the cast can be expanded to 26 actors. Actors range in age from 16 to 65 years of age. HAVE YOU EVER THOUGHT OF BEING IN A PLAY, BUT DIDN'T WANT A LARGE ROLE? HERE'S YOUR CHANCE!

The four main characters include:

Don Browning - Adult writer, young boy in flashbacks.
Dad - Don's father.
Mom - Don's mother, past and present.
Sis - Don's sister, past and present.

Multiple character male roles:
The following parts may be portrayed by one person or up to 13 individuals. These are small roles and can be played by nearly any age 16 to 65.

Farmer Johnson - Farmer with a silo.
Grandpa - Don's grandfather.
Cart Guy - Grocery store employee.
Uncle Phil - Don's uncle.
Joe Hofingers - Farmer with a hoe.
Amish Guy - Amish peddler at a flea market.
Civil War Guy - Civil War performer and narrator.
Jack Singer - Don's childhood friend, now a professor.
Mechanic - Fixes Don's car.
Park Ranger - Helpful park ranger.
Clerk - Unhappy old man.
Wayne - Stoic waiter with a mullet.
Bob - Hog farmer.

Multiple character female roles:
The following parts may be portrayed by one person or up to 9 individuals. These are small roles and can be played by nearly any age 16 to 65.

Mrs. Johnson - Farmer's wife with silo.
Grandma - Don's grandmother.
Aunt Phyllis - Don's aunt.
Amish Gal - Amish peddler at flea market.
Museum Assistant - Civil War Guy's announcer.
Jamie - Mechanic.
Drunk Lady - Patron in a hotel.
Jessie - Talkative waitress.
Judy - Hog Farmer Bob's wife.

PACT Announces Summer Performance Director

Holly Beehn The Pittsville Area Community Theater is pleased to welcome and introduce Holly Beehn as the director of this summer's PACT production.

Holly brings a wealth of experience to the stage, having been involved in all aspects of theater for over 25 years. Originally from the Marshfield area, she moved to Madison, Wisconsin after graduating from college. While in Madison she was involved with many different theater groups, having acted in numerous productions. She had her directorial debut in 2001.

Since moving back to the area in 2006, Holly has acted in local productions, including: "Antigone", "Inherit the Wind" and "Crazy For You" with the Campus Community Players of Marshfield. With her father, Steve Allar, Holly has co-directed "Beverly Hillbillies", "Home for Christmas", "Annie" and "Anne Frank and Me" at Auburndale High School.

Holly and her husband, Michael, live in Hewitt and have two sons, Noah [5 years old] and Nash [18 months old]. At her church she started the band, "Voices of Faith", which she continues to direct today. Holly works full time as a Project Manager at Saint Joseph's Hospital in Marshfield. When not on stage, she enjoys traveling and spending time with her family and friends.

An announcement of the title of the PACT production will be made soon. Auditions are set for May 17th and 18th, with rehearsals beginning on June 1st. Performances will be held in the Pittsville Schools Auditorium on July 22nd-25th, 2010. Please stay tuned for more information!
